Premiere Rug Service Established in 1976 Serving the Tri-State area

1. Konkrete Techniken zur Optimierung der Nutzerführung bei Interaktiven Elementen

a) Einsatz von visuellen Hinweisen und Signalen

Die gezielte Verwendung von visuellen Hinweisen ist essenziell, um Nutzer intuitiv durch eine Webseite zu steuern. Hover-Effekte, animierte Icons und subtile Schattenwürfe signalisieren Interaktivität klar und unmissverständlich. Beispielsweise kann ein Button bei Hover durch eine leichte Farbänderung oder einen Schatteneffekt aufleuchten, um die Aufmerksamkeit des Nutzers zu lenken. Für eine professionelle Umsetzung empfiehlt es sich, CSS-Transitions zu verwenden, um sanfte Effekte zu erzielen:




b) Verwendung von klaren, konsistenten Farbkontrasten

Farbkontraste sind ein entscheidendes Element für die Sichtbarkeit und Zugänglichkeit interaktiver Komponenten. Ein gut durchdachtes Farbkonzept sorgt dafür, dass Buttons, Links und Menüs sofort als klickbare Elemente erkannt werden. Empfehlenswert ist, bei der Gestaltung auf die WCAG-Richtlinien zu achten, beispielsweise einen Kontrastwert von mindestens 4,5:1 zwischen Text und Hintergrund zu gewährleisten. Für die Praxis empfiehlt sich die Verwendung von Tools wie dem WebAIM Contrast Checker, um die Kontraste zu prüfen.

c) Gestaltung von intuitiven Call-to-Action-Buttons

Eine klare, auffällige Gestaltung von Call-to-Action-Buttons (CTA) ist essenziell für die Nutzerführung. Hierbei sollten Sie auf eine eindeutige Beschriftung setzen, etwa „Jetzt kaufen“ oder „Mehr erfahren“. Um die Konversion zu steigern, empfiehlt sich die Verwendung von Farben, die emotional ansprechen – Rot für Dringlichkeit, Grün für Sicherheit. Zudem sollte die Größe des Buttons ausreichend sein, um auch auf mobilen Geräten gut erkennbar zu sein. Als Best Practice gilt es, die Buttons mit CSS zu gestalten, die bei Interaktion eine visuelle Rückmeldung geben, z. B. durch Farbwechsel oder eine leichte Vergrößerung:


  Jetzt kaufen



d) Einsatz von Mikrointeraktionen

Mikrointeraktionen sind kleine, fokussierte Animationen oder Effekte, die Nutzer bei einzelnen Aktionen unterstützen und für ein angenehmes Nutzungserlebnis sorgen. Beispiele sind das sanfte Einblenden eines Icons bei Hover, das kurze Wackeln eines Buttons bei fehlerhafter Eingabe oder das automatische Anzeigen eines Tooltip-Texts bei Mausüberfahrt. Solche Details erhöhen die Nutzerbindung erheblich und lenken subtil die Aufmerksamkeit auf relevante Funktionen. Für die Umsetzung eignen sich JavaScript-Frameworks wie Anime.js oder GSAP, die eine präzise Steuerung von Animationen erlauben.

2. Praktische Umsetzung von Feedback-Mechanismen und Statusanzeigen

a) Effektive Integration von Ladeindikatoren, Erfolgsmeldungen und Fehlermeldungen

Benutzer erwarten bei Interaktionen wie Formularübermittlungen oder Seitenwechsel eine klare Rückmeldung. Ladeindikatoren sollten dezent, aber sichtbar sein, z. B. durch einen kleinen animierten Spinner, der über CSS-Animationen realisiert wird. Erfolgsmeldungen sind nach erfolgreicher Aktion grün hinterlegt, beispielsweise durch ein kurzes Banner oder eine Snackbar, die automatisch nach einigen Sekunden verschwindet. Bei Fehlern ist eine deutliche visuelle Hervorhebung erforderlich, etwa durch rote Rahmen und klare Textnachrichten. Wichtig ist, dass diese Meldungen zugänglich sind, also auch von Screenreadern erkannt werden.

b) Anwendungsbeispiele für visuelles und akustisches Feedback

Beim Ausfüllen eines Kontaktformulars kann ein akustisches Signal (z. B. ein kurzer Ton) bei erfolgreicher Eingabe helfen, während visuelle Hinweise wie das automatische Hervorheben des fehlerhaften Feldes bei falscher Eingabe die Nutzerführung verbessern. Bei Navigationsmenüs ist es sinnvoll, bei der Auswahl eines Menüpunkts eine kleine Animation oder Farbänderung zu verwenden, um den Nutzer zu bestätigen, dass die Auswahl registriert wurde. Auch bei komplexen Aktionen wie Daten-Uploads kann eine Fortschrittsanzeige die Nutzer beruhigen und die Wahrnehmung der Bedienungssicherheit erhöhen.

c) Schritt-für-Schritt-Anleitung zur Programmierung dynamischer Statusanzeigen

Um eine dynamische Statusanzeige mit JavaScript und CSS zu erstellen, gehen Sie wie folgt vor:

  1. HTML-Struktur für den Statusbereich erstellen, z. B. <div id=”status”></div>.
  2. CSS-Stile für den Standard-, Lade- und Erfolg-Status definieren, z. B.:
    #status {
      padding: 10px;
      border-radius: 5px;
      display: none;
    }
    #status.loading { display: block; background-color: #fff3cd; color: #856404; }
    #status.success { display: block; background-color: #d4edda; color: #155724; }
    
  3. JavaScript zur Steuerung der Anzeigen implementieren:
    function showStatus(type, message) {
      var statusDiv = document.getElementById('status');
      statusDiv.className = type;
      statusDiv.textContent = message;
      statusDiv.style.display = 'block';
      if (type === 'loading') {
        // Automatisches Verbergen nach 3 Sekunden
        setTimeout(function() { statusDiv.style.display = 'none'; }, 3000);
      }
    }
    

3. Vermeidung Häufiger Fehler bei der Nutzerführung in Interaktiven Elementen

a) Typische Designfehler vermeiden

Zu den häufigsten Fehlern zählt eine Überladung von Seiten mit zu vielen interaktiven Elementen, die den Nutzer verwirren und die Orientierung erschweren. Auch unklare Call-to-Actions, die nicht eindeutig formuliert oder visuell hervorgehoben sind, führen zu Frustration und Abbrüchen. Weiterhin sollte auf eine konsistente Gestaltung sowie auf die Vermeidung von „Clickbait“-ähnlichen Elementen geachtet werden, um das Vertrauen der Nutzer zu bewahren.

b) Fallbeispiele für schlechte Nutzerführung

Ein bekanntes deutsches E-Commerce-Portal zeigte bei einem Test, dass unklare Button-Beschriftungen wie „Weiter“ ohne Kontext zu Verwirrung führten. Nutzer klickten mehrfach, da sie nicht sicher waren, was genau passieren würde. Diese Unsicherheit führte zu einer niedrigen Conversion-Rate und erhöhten Abbruchquoten. Solche Beispiele verdeutlichen, wie mangelnde Klarheit in der Nutzerführung direkte Umsatzeinbußen verursachen kann.

c) Strategien zur Fehlerprävention

Zur Vermeidung dieser Fehler empfiehlt es sich, Nutzer-Tests durchzuführen, z. B. mit A/B-Testing-Tools wie Optimizely oder Google Optimize. Usability-Analysen und Nutzerumfragen helfen, kritische Punkte frühzeitig zu erkennen. Ein weiterer Ansatz ist die Nutzung von Heuristiken, um die Verständlichkeit zu prüfen, beispielsweise durch Checklisten zu Interaktionsdesigns. Regelmäßige Feedback-Runden mit echten Nutzern sichern eine kontinuierliche Optimierung der Nutzerführung.

4. Detaillierte Fallstudien: Erfolgreiche Implementierungen in der Praxis

a) Analyse eines deutschen E-Commerce-Portals

Ein führendes deutsches Modeportal führte eine umfassende Nutzeranalyse durch, bei der Schwachstellen in der Navigation und bei den Produkt-CTAs identifiziert wurden. Durch schrittweise Verbesserungen, wie die Einführung klarer Farbkontraste, animierter Hover-Effekte bei Produktbildern und optimierte CTA-Buttons, stieg die Klickrate auf die Kauf-Buttons um 15 %. Die Implementierung von Mikrointeraktionen bei Hover-States führte zudem zu längeren Verweildauern und höherer Nutzerzufriedenheit.

b) Beispiel eines öffentlichen Verwaltungsportals

Das deutsche Bürgerportal „MeinBerlin“ wurde durch gezielte Interaktionsdesigns deutlich nutzerfreundlicher gestaltet. Indikatoren für Ladezeiten wurden durch dezente Spinner ersetzt, success-meldungen wurden prominent aber nicht aufdringlich platziert, und Formulare wurden durch Inline-Validierungen mit klaren Fehlermeldungen optimiert. Die Folge: Nutzer konnten Anträge deutlich schneller und fehlerfreier abschließen, was die Zufriedenheit erheblich steigerte und die Bearbeitungszeiten verringerte.

c) Lessons Learned

Bei der Umsetzung solcher Projekte ist entscheidend, Nutzerfeedback frühzeitig einzuholen und kontinuierlich zu testen. Es zeigte sich, dass kleine, inkrementelle Änderungen oft nachhaltiger sind als große Überarbeitungen. Zudem sollte die technische Umsetzung stets barrierefrei erfolgen, um alle Nutzergruppen zu erreichen. Die Dokumentation der Nutzerreaktionen und die Analyse von Verhaltensdaten sichern eine langfristige Optimierung der Nutzerführung.

5. Technische Umsetzung: Integration in Frameworks und Content-Management-Systeme

a) Implementierung in WordPress, TYPO3 & Co.

Bei populären CMS-Systemen wie WordPress oder TYPO3 lassen sich Nutzerführungskonzepte durch Plugins und individuelle Templates effizient umsetzen. Für WordPress empfiehlt sich die Nutzung von Page-Builder-Plugins wie Elementor oder Beaver Builder, die Drag-and-Drop-Funktionen für Call-to-Action-Buttons und interaktive Elemente bieten. Dabei ist es wichtig, eigene CSS- und JavaScript-Codes nahtlos zu integrieren, um konsistente Effekte zu erzielen. Für TYPO3 sind Extensions wie „Flux“ hilfreich, um dynamische Inhalte und Statusanzeigen zu realisieren. Wichtig ist die Einhaltung der Barrierefreiheit und die Kompatibilität mit mobilen Endgeräten.

b) Nutzung von JavaScript-Bibliotheken

Fortgeschrittene Animationen und Mikrointeraktionen lassen sich mit JavaScript-Bibliotheken wie GSAP oder Anime.js realisieren. Diese Bibliotheken bieten präzise Steuerung, Sequenzierung und Optimierung für komplexe Effekte. Beispiel: Mit GSAP kann ein Button beim Klick eine kurze, elegante Animation durchlaufen, die Nutzer visuell bestätigt. Hier ein einfaches Beispiel:


Leave a Reply

Your email address will not be published. Required fields are marked *